Buying Guide

A short, focused buying guide helps you choose the right gadget for realistic breakfast prep. Start by thinking in terms of tasks: chopping, slicing, smashing, and sealing. Each task has different priorities—speed, cleanup, durability, or gentle handling for delicate fruit.

1) What matters most: If you’re prepping for photos or videos, consistent slices and neat presentation matter. For family breakfasts, safety, speed and a container to catch messes are priorities. Look for non-slip bases, enclosed containers, and dishwasher-safe parts.

2) Blade variety vs. simplicity: Multi-blade choppers (like a 12-in-1) cover many tasks but add parts to store and clean. Single-purpose fruit slicers cost less and are quicker to use for small jobs—perfect for strawberries or banana slices for cereal.

3) Materials and cookware safety: For pans and non-stick surfaces, choose heat-resistant tools (nylon or silicone) to avoid scratching. For contact with acidic fruit or dairy, look for BPA-free plastics and stainless steel blades.

4) Cleanup and storage: Removable blades and parts that fit in a standard dishwasher rack save time. If you have limited cabinet space, prefer compact designs that nest or stack.

5) Durability and repeated use: For daily meal prep, look for reinforced handles and thicker plastics. Read product Q&A and verified reviews to see if parts warp or blades dull with time.

6) Who should splurge vs. skip: If you prep breakfast for a household of four every morning, investing in a versatile chopper and a sturdy meat masher is worth it. If you only slice fruit occasionally, a simple detachable strawberry slicer can be a cheaper, lower-maintenance choice.
